				<title>2013 Aprilia SBK Season Launch</title> 
				<description>&lt;b&gt;Aprilia officially launched its fifth SBK season today in Milan: an outstanding performer in the last 4 race seasons, with 4 world championship titles.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Northern Ireland rider Eugene Laverty, on the Aprilia RSV4 for the second year, to be flanked by Aprilia’s new acquisition, 30-year-old French rider Sylvain Guintoli.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
An extraordinary track-record: 51 world title victories in twenty years. The medal board of the Piaggio Group is even more impressive, with its brands winning a total of 101 world titles, making the Group the most successful European and Western motorcycle manufacturer ever.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;

				<title>AF1 Track Review: Zero S Electric Motorcycle</title> 
				<description>The final complex of the Texas World Speedway course is a series of increasingly tight corners that culminate in a sharp S bend. Hugging the inside curbing as you exit the final left hand turn allows the rider to exit the course into pit lane and the safety of the paddock. Drift to the outside, however, and you begin the run along TSW's banked and slightly curving front straight. Cracking open the throttle here rewards the rider with a glorious caucophony of sound as pistons hurl themselves across their chambers. Noxious gasses bark as they are expelled from from exhaust cannons, the mad wailing echoing off the NASCAR banking and up into the stadium sections.
